ROL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review
466 of the 6,340 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Rollins (ROL)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$6.94B — up 7.1% from $6.48B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 64 funds closed out of ROL and 55 opened new positions — a net loss of 9 holders — while 171 trimmed existing stakes and 168 added.
The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$267M. The largest seller was First Trust Advisors, cutting an estimated $56.7M.
